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
40158312 107161627 195024838
09451 72 4137083
09451 72 4137083
85740728 2216421 0690290622
All about undefined
Interested in learning more?
09451 72 4137083
85740728 2216421 0690290622
See more
97620443 572
090807031 906 76254248930
See more
2174 1383156
5181 48747 2468506
See more